Description : |
Ernest Giles reconnoitered ahead of his main party with Alfred Gibson. Sand-hills and undulating gravelly plains stretched ahead of them, with no evidence of water anywhere. The way ahead was no better than it had been further to the south. They were forced to turn back. One of their two horses died of thirst, and reluctantly Giles decided to send Gibson back alone, to ride in their outgoing tracks, back to a cache of water and then to the depot where the main party waited. He was then to return with help for Giles who would attempt to walk back on foot. Two days prior to this, Giles had decided to reduce their small party by releasing the two pack horses to find their own way back, and after watering the two riding horses, cached the remaining ten gallons of water in two casks in a tree. This would be there for the return to the main depot. He then continued on with Gibson, hoping that the country would change for the better. |
